Two weeks ago we leaned of a lawsuit being filed against Lance Dutson, the gentleman from Maine who dared to criticize the poor work of Maine Department of Tourism's advertising vendor, New York-based advertising firm Warren Kremer Piano Advertising, LLC.
Cliff Notes: Lance is a guy who blogs about technology and Maine. He frequently writes about Maine's tourism business and got into this scrap with the Department of Tourism for its PPC advertising campaign, which he contends hurt, rather than helped Maine business. Along the way he found some shoddy artwork created by WKPA, LLC on behalf of the Maine Dpt. of Tourism and mentioned that on his blog, www.mainewebreport.com as well.
WKPA sued Lance and quickly learned how blogs have become a great equalizer.
There's word today that WKPA has dropped its suit against Lance. Now, while the advertising firm won't be able to get rid of the negative after-effects of its proposed suit on the Web, today's action ought to create a little good will for itself.
